NWI Comic Con 2019


Geeks A Gogo spent this past Saturday at Northwest Indiana Comic Con at the Halls of St. George in Schererville, IN. This is the 6th year for this event, and we have attended every year, watching this convention rapidly grow from a small local convention into a sizeable event that draws over 3,000 people every year! It's always fun to start off our convention-going season with this show.

This year was much like pasts years with a great artist alley featuring both local artists and publishers, such as Guerilla Publishing Group, to artists who work for big-name publishers like DC and Dark Horse. There were plenty of vendors selling comics, toys, board games, role-playing games, and other geek items, and you could even stop by and talk to the folks at Chimera Comics about their comic book store giveaway! And being the gaming nerds that we are, we were pleased that we even got to do some role-playing game demos with the folks from the Indie Game Developer Network! Of course, as with every year, there was the big cosplay contest on the main stage. This year Geeks A Gogo founder Monica Paprocki returned as a cosplay judge for the adult cosplay competition, alongside Christopher English of Papabear Cosplay and James Wulfgar of Wulfgar Weapons and Props.
